AttachablePropertyServices.CopyPropertiesTo Método
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Copia todos os pares de valor/propriedade anexáveis de um repositório de propriedades anexáveis especificado para uma matriz de destino.
public:
static void CopyPropertiesTo(System::Object ^ instance, cli::array <System::Collections::Generic::KeyValuePair<System::Xaml::AttachableMemberIdentifier ^, System::Object ^>> ^ array, int index);
public static void CopyPropertiesTo (object instance, System.Collections.Generic.KeyValuePair<System.Xaml.AttachableMemberIdentifier,object>[] array, int index);
static member CopyPropertiesTo : obj * System.Collections.Generic.KeyValuePair<System.Xaml.AttachableMemberIdentifier, obj>[] * int -> unit
Public Shared Sub CopyPropertiesTo (instance As Object, array As KeyValuePair(Of AttachableMemberIdentifier, Object)(), index As Integer)
Parâmetros
- instance
- Object
Um repositório de propriedades anexáveis específico que implementa IAttachedPropertyStore; ou qualquer objeto não nulo para acessar um repositório de propriedades anexáveis padrão estático.
- array
- KeyValuePair<AttachableMemberIdentifier,Object>[]
A matriz de destino. A matriz é uma matriz genérica, deve ser passada não dimensionada e deve ter os componentes de AttachableMemberIdentifier e object
.
- index
- Int32
O índice de origem para o qual copiar.
Comentários
Chamar esse método invoca uma implementação subjacente CopyTo restrita com um par chave/valor, que pode ser a fonte de exceções que não estão listadas neste tópico.